Please sync dnsmasq 2.47-3 (main) from Debian unstable (main).

Bug #328992 reported by Thierry Carrez
4
Affects Status Importance Assigned to Milestone
dnsmasq (Ubuntu)
Fix Released
Wishlist
Unassigned

Bug Description

Binary package hint: dnsmasq

Please sync dnsmasq 2.47-3 (main) from Debian unstable (main).
This should also fix LP: #291186, #318781 for us.

Explanation of the Ubuntu delta and why it can be dropped:
The only remaining delta was the TearDrop spec implementation, which
was pushed back to Debian and fixed in 2.47-1 (Debian bug #506734).

Changelog since current jaunty version 2.46-1ubuntu1:

dnsmasq (2.47-3) unstable; urgency=low

   * Fix bashism in init script. (closes: #514397)
   * Tweak logging in init script.

 -- Simon Kelley <email address hidden> Sat, 7 Feb 2009 19:25:23 +0000

dnsmasq (2.47-2) unstable; urgency=low

   * Check that /etc/init.d/dnsmasq is executable in postinst in case
     the daemon has been disabled that way. (closes: #514314)
   * Ensure that /var/run/dnsmasq exists and has the right permissions
     before running dnsmasq. On some systems /var/run is cleared over
     reboot. (closes: #514317)

 -- Simon Kelley <email address hidden> Fri, 6 Feb 2009 09:38:21 +0000

dnsmasq (2.47-1) unstable; urgency=low

   * New upstream.
   * Handle the "ENABLED" flag in the init script a bit more
     intelligently. The "stop" and "status" functions continue
     to work even when disabled, but a failed "stop" becomes
     silent and returns zero exit code.
   * Don't explicitly kill dnsmasq at system shutdown, rely on the
     sendsigs script instead which is quicker. (closes: #506734)
   * Store the PID-file in /var/run/dnsmasq. This directory is owned by
     user "dnsmasq", so that dnsmasq can delete the PID-file on
     shutdown. This ensures that the the PID-file goes even when dnsmasq
     is stopped by sendsigs. (closes: #508560).
   * Bump standards-version to 3.8.0 (no changes required.)
   * /usr/sbin/adduser -> adduser in postinst. Lintian fix.
   * Handle IPv6 addresses in "tentative" state better. (closes: #507646).
   * Add DBus introspection support. (closes: #508774)
   * Fix Dbus configuration. (closes: #510649)

 -- Simon Kelley <email address hidden> Mon, 2 Feb 2009 13:39:11 +0000

Thierry Carrez (ttx)
Changed in dnsmasq:
importance: Undecided → Wishlist
Revision history for this message
Mathias Gug (mathiaz) wrote :

ACK.

Revision history for this message
James Westby (james-w) wrote :

[Updating] dnsmasq (2.46-1ubuntu1 [Ubuntu] < 2.47-3 [Debian])
 * Trying to add dnsmasq...
  - <dnsmasq_2.47.orig.tar.gz: downloading from http://ftp.debian.org/debian/>
  - <dnsmasq_2.47-3.dsc: downloading from http://ftp.debian.org/debian/>
  - <dnsmasq_2.47-3.diff.gz: downloading from http://ftp.debian.org/debian/>
I: dnsmasq [main] -> dnsmasq_2.46-1ubuntu1 [universe].
I: dnsmasq [main] -> dnsmasq-base_2.46-1ubuntu1 [main].

Changed in dnsmasq:
status: New →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.